首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Python xlrd解析问题

Python xlrd是一个用于解析Excel文件的库。它可以读取Excel文件中的数据,并提供了一些方法来操作和处理这些数据。

xlrd库的主要功能包括:

  1. 解析Excel文件:xlrd可以读取Excel文件中的数据,包括单元格的值、格式、公式等。
  2. 获取工作簿和工作表:xlrd可以获取Excel文件中的工作簿和工作表,可以通过索引或名称来访问它们。
  3. 读取单元格数据:xlrd可以读取单元格中的数据,包括文本、数字、日期、布尔值等。
  4. 处理合并单元格:xlrd可以处理合并单元格,可以获取合并单元格的值和范围。
  5. 处理日期和时间:xlrd可以将Excel中的日期和时间转换为Python的datetime对象。
  6. 处理公式:xlrd可以读取Excel中的公式,并提供了一些方法来计算公式的值。
  7. 处理样式和格式:xlrd可以读取单元格的样式和格式,包括字体、颜色、对齐方式等。
  8. 处理图表和图片:xlrd可以读取Excel中的图表和图片,并提供了一些方法来处理它们。

Python xlrd的优势包括:

  1. 简单易用:xlrd提供了简单易用的API,使得解析Excel文件变得非常容易。
  2. 跨平台支持:xlrd可以在多个操作系统上运行,包括Windows、Linux和Mac。
  3. 大文件支持:xlrd可以处理大型的Excel文件,不会因为文件大小而导致性能下降。
  4. 兼容性好:xlrd可以解析多个版本的Excel文件,包括Excel 2003和Excel 2007等。
  5. 社区活跃:xlrd是一个开源项目,拥有活跃的社区支持和更新。

Python xlrd的应用场景包括:

  1. 数据分析:xlrd可以帮助开发人员读取和处理Excel文件中的数据,用于数据分析和统计。
  2. 数据导入导出:xlrd可以将Excel文件中的数据导入到数据库中,或将数据库中的数据导出为Excel文件。
  3. 报表生成:xlrd可以读取Excel文件中的数据,并根据需求生成各种报表和图表。
  4. 数据清洗:xlrd可以读取Excel文件中的数据,并进行清洗和处理,去除重复项、空值等。
  5. 数据转换:xlrd可以读取Excel文件中的数据,并将其转换为其他格式,如CSV、JSON等。

腾讯云相关产品和产品介绍链接地址:

腾讯云提供了多个与数据处理和存储相关的产品,以下是一些推荐的产品和其介绍链接地址:

  1. 腾讯云对象存储(COS):腾讯云对象存储(COS)是一种安全、持久、高可用的云存储服务,适用于存储和处理任意类型的文件和数据。详细介绍请参考:https://cloud.tencent.com/product/cos
  2. 腾讯云数据库(TencentDB):腾讯云数据库(TencentDB)是一种高性能、可扩展的云数据库服务,支持多种数据库引擎,包括MySQL、SQL Server、MongoDB等。详细介绍请参考:https://cloud.tencent.com/product/cdb
  3. 腾讯云数据万象(CI):腾讯云数据万象(CI)是一种智能化的图片和视频处理服务,提供了丰富的图像和视频处理功能,如图片剪裁、水印添加、视频转码等。详细介绍请参考:https://cloud.tencent.com/product/ci

请注意,以上推荐的腾讯云产品仅供参考,具体选择和使用需根据实际需求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Python中的xlrd模块使用原理解析

on里面的xlrd模块详解(一) – 疯了的小蜗 – 博客园【内容】: 那我就一下面积个问题xlrd模块进行学习一下: 什么是xlrd模块? 为什么使用xlrd模块?...1.什么是xlrd模块?   ♦python操作excel主要用到xlrd和xlwt这两个库,即xlrd是读excel,xlwt是写excel的库。...今天就先来说一下xlrd模块: 一、安装xlrd模块   ♦ 到python官网下载http://pypi.python.org/pypi/xlrd模块安装,前提是已经安装了python 环境。   ...注意:注意作用域问题,之前获取的sheet之后,都在获取到这个sheet值后,在进行,行和列以及单元格的操作。...问题现象:   ♦1、使用open()函数、xlrd.open_workbook()函数打开文件,文件名若包含中文,会报错找不到这个文件或目录。   ♦2、获取sheet时若包含中文,也会报错。

1.2K10

Pythonxlrd、xlwt模块)操

一、前言 关于Pythonxlrd、xlwt模块的使用,推介另一位博客主的博文:https://www.cnblogs.com/zhoujie/p/python18.html 这篇里面有详细介绍这两个模块的基本用法...以下是关于我运用xlrd、xlwt模块的一个实例。需求如下: ?...需求是用宏去做的,但是因为时间比较紧急,我用了1天去“研究”怎么用宏去写,发现作为一个VBA入门者,比较难短时间学习并解决这个问题,因为VBA的可读性比较差的缘故吧。...---- 总结 应该说Pythonxlrd、xlwt模块对于Excel的数据读取和写入非常简易方便。...但是在使用xlwt时,存在一个问题,就是它无法直接对现有的Excel工作表进行写入,只能新开一个Excel。或者将现有Excel复制一个副本,另存为。

93620

python读取excel进行遍历xlrd模块操作

/usr/bin/env python # -*- coding: utf-8 -*- import csv import xlrd import xlwt def handler_excel(filename...=r'/Users/zongyang.yu/horizon/ops_platform/assets/upload/1.xlsl'): # 打开文件 workbook = xlrd.open_workbook...遍历一个文件夹下有几个Excel文件及每个Excel文件有几个Sheet 一、 解决问题: 工作中常会遇到合并Excel文件的需求,Excel文件数量不确定,里面的Sheet 数量是可变的,Sheet...二、系统环境: OS:Win 10 64位 Python版本:3.7 三、准备: 1、文件路径:C:\Work\Python\MergeExel 编写的python文件放在此文件路径下 2、在上面这个文件路径下建立一个...以上这篇python读取excel进行遍历/xlrd模块操作就是小编分享给大家的全部内容了,希望能给大家一个参考。

4.4K30

python+xlrd+xlwt操作ex

介绍 ---- xlrd(读操作),xlwt(写操作) 上述软件下载后,分别解压,之后在cmd命令下分别进入对应的目录中运行 python setup.py install 如果运行过程中提示缺少setuptools...,则先运行python ez_setup.py之后在重复上面的步骤 PS:office的版本不要用太高的,建议最好用03版本的,且后缀为xls的 源码bug修复 ---- 安装好xlwt3后,找到formula.py...xcall_refs"] 修改为 __slots__ = [ "__s", "__parser", "__sheet_refs", "__xcall_refs"] 实战 ---- 不废话,码起来~ import xlrd...import xlwt3 path = 'excel所在的路径-小强测试品牌' #打开excel def open_excel(path): try: workbook = xlrd.open_workbook...xlwt3.Workbook()#创建工作薄 sheet=wb.add_sheet("xlwt3数据测试表",cell_overwrite_ok=True)#创建工作表 value = [["名称", "小强python

62910

Python Excel 操作 | xlrd+xlwt 模块笔记

Python 的pandas模块使用xlrd作为读取 excel 文件的默认引擎。但是,xlrd在其最新版本(从 2.0.1 版本开始)中删除了对 xls 文件以外的任何文件的支持。...In particular, it appeared that defusedxml and xlrd did not work on Python 3.9, which lead people to...从官方的邮件中,说的应该是 xlsx 本身是由一个 zip 文件和 xml 的头文件构成的,但是 xml 和 zip 都有详细记录的安全问题,特别是,defusedxml和xlrd似乎在 Python..._3 conda-forge 上面的问题将导致您在使用pandas调用 xlsx excel 上的read_excel函数时收到一个错误,即不再支持 xlsx filetype。...为了解决这个问题,你可以: 安装 openpyxl 模块:这是另一个仍然支持 xlsx 格式的 excel 处理包。

1.4K50

Anaconda安装Python表格文件处理包xlrd

本文介绍在Anaconda环境下,安装Python读取.xls格式表格文件的库xlrd的方法。...xlrd是一个用于读取Excel文件的Python库,下面是xlrd库的一些主要特点和功能: 读取Excel文件:xlrd可以打开和读取Excel文件,并提取其中的数据和元数据。...处理日期和时间:xlrd可以正确解析Excel文件中的日期和时间,并将其转换为Python的日期和时间对象。 支持公式:xlrd可以读取Excel文件中的公式,并返回计算后的结果。   ...在这里有一点需要注意:如果我们开启了网络代理软件,则可能会导致系统找不到xlrd库元数据的下载地址,导致出现错误;针对这种情况,我们可以将相关网络软件暂时关闭,或者采用Anaconda虚拟环境安装Python...为了验证我们xlrd库的安装是否成功,我们可以在编译器中尝试加载xlrd库;若发现可以成功加载,则说明xlrd库安装无误。   至此,大功告成。

37010

Python以及Pycharm的matplotlib和xlrd安装方法

、安装pip包(一般下载时都会自带),在安装成功的Python里面寻找easy_install工具,基本都在安装Python路径的Scrpits中,如图。...以及pip install xlrd进行需要包的安装,这里额外说一下,matplotlib安装前还需要安装 numpy和scipy这两个包,方法一致。...下图就是安装好pip以后,调用pip安装xlrd包的过程,因为已经存在,显示如下(pip安装好以后,在此打开pip才可用,不然无法识别) pyharm使用报的情况: 因为pycharm...Python安装直接找寻Python的路径,而pycharm则要寻找pycharm所建项目的路径。...IE9以下不支持 IE9,10,11存在以下问题 不支持离线功能 IE9不支持文件导入导出 IE10不支持拖拽文件导入 ---- ---- 这里是 脚注 的 内容. ↩ 发布者:全栈程序员栈长,转载请注明出处

1.5K10

扫码

添加站长 进交流群

领取专属 10元无门槛券

手把手带您无忧上云

扫码加入开发者社群

相关资讯

热门标签

活动推荐

    运营活动

    活动名称
    广告关闭
    领券